Many hands make light work in Sexsmith

May 9, 2024

The Sexsmith and Area Food Bank made its move to a new home on May 1. Volunteers helped carry boxes and set up shelves to bring the stored food from the food bank’s old location in a building adjacent to the Grace Bible Fellowship Church to a room in the Sexsmith Community Centre. National Aboriginal Hockey Championships opening ceremony

May 9, 2024
The National Aboriginal Hockey Championship brought the region over 350 athletes and officials. "This elite sporting event marks a significant milestone as it lands in Alberta for the first time in its history,” said City of Grande Prairie Mayor Jackie Clayton.
